Credentials: BSc, MD, MPH, MSc (Clinical Epidemiology), MEd (Health Sciences Education); Diplomate - Philippine Board of Otolaryngology - Head and Neck Surgery

In the Division of Care of the Elderly, my main role is to support research, quality improvement, and other scholarly projects of trainees and faculty members. I bring to work a smorgasbord of credentials in medicine, epidemiology, education, quality improvement, and project management. Across the Pacific Ocean, in the Philippines, I am a certified otolaryngologist.
